Transaction 20d89d5965fb6814692a3155babd84a7b6e8966bc5e8d6969d48ea4008a21c27
1 Input
1 Output
-
20d89d5965fb6814692a3155babd84a7b6e8966bc5e8d6969d48ea4008a21c27:0
- value
- 312696
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0eefb9f9cb306bc087d6010ece571004dcf9541b OP_EQUALVERIFY OP_CHECKSIG
- address
- 12MyeB1gXys4cxwwZVKPmRtYAZEiGyVFUD